tvrdí

"Tvrdí" in English means "claims" or "asserts."


In this sentence, 'tvrdí' is used as a verb meaning 'claims' or 'asserts,' indicating that someone is stating something as a fact.

On tvrdí, že má pravdu.

He claims that he is right.


Here, 'tvrdí' refers to the book's content making a claim or statement about a certain topic.

Táto kniha tvrdí, že vesmír je nekonečný.

This book asserts that the universe is infinite.


In this context, 'tvrdí' is used to describe a recurring behavior of making contrary statements.

Ona vždy tvrdí opak.

She always claims the opposite.
